Gaza Offensive and Journalist Deaths

  • 🎯 An Israeli airstrike in Gaza resulted in the deaths of five Al Jazeera journalists, including Anas al-Sharif.
  • ⚠️ Israel alleged al-Sharif headed a Hamas cell and was involved in rocket attacks, a claim Al Jazeera rejected, calling him one of Gaza's bravest journalists.
  • πŸ“ˆ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u stated Israel intends to complete a new offensive targeting Gaza City "fairly quickly," aiming to defeat Hamas.
  • 🌍 International reactions to the planned offensive have caused alarm, with concerns about further displacement of civilians in Gaza.
  • πŸ‡¦πŸ‡Ί Australia has announced it will recognize a Palestinian state at the upcoming UN General Assembly, contingent on Hamas having no involvement in a future state.

Trump, National Guard, and Homelessness

  • 🏠 President Donald Trump pledged to evict homeless people from Washington D.C. as part of a crime crackdown.
  • βš–οΈ A landmark trial has begun in San Francisco examining the Trump administration's decision to deploy the National Guard in Los Angeles.
  • πŸ“œ The trial questions the president's authority to use federal troops for domestic law enforcement, potentially testing legal standards for military deployment on US soil.
  • πŸ“‰ The mayor of Washington D.C. stated that violent crime is down in the city, contradicting claims of a crime spike.

Chip Sales and Infrastructure Projects

  • πŸ’» Major American chip makers, including Nvidia and AMD, have agreed to provide the US government with 15% of revenue from certain China sales of advanced computer chips.
  • πŸ”’ This agreement follows previous halts on chip sales over national security concerns, with a US official believing the deal does not compromise security.
  • πŸŒ‰ Italy has approved plans for the construction of the world's longest single-span bridge, connecting Sicily to the mainland.
  • πŸ—οΈ The project faces opposition due to seismic risks and environmental concerns, alongside fears of mafia infiltration in the construction process.
  • πŸ’° Supporters argue the bridge will significantly benefit the economies of Sicily and Calabria, among Italy's less developed regions.
